Types of Interactions Between Health and Homelessness. In examining the relationship between homelessness and health, the committee observed that there are three different types of interactions: (1) Some health problems precede and causally contribute to homelessness, (2) others are consequences of homelessness, and (3) homelessness complicates the treatment of many illnesses.…

Providing knowledge of specific health issues and practices can have a dramatic effect on the health of a community.
